On Thu, Jun 08, 2023 at 09:24:18AM +0200, Ahmad Fatoum wrote:
> Best practice is for each board to populate $global.system.partitions
> or $global.fastboot.partitions with a string exporting its flashable
> devices in a descriptive manner, e.g. "/dev/mmc0(eMMC),/dev/mmc1(SD)".
> 
> This often goes into BSPs though, so upstream boards are left without
> default partitions, making use a bit cumbersome. Make this easier
> by providing three new magic specifiers:
> 
>   - nvmem: exports all registered NVMEM devices (e.g. EEPROMs, Fuse banks)
>   - block: exports all registered block devices (e.g. eMMC and SD)
>   - auto:  currently equivalent to "nvmem,block". May be extended
>            to raw MTD and UBI in future
> 
> This makes it easy to export devices on any board:
> 
>   usbgadget -A auto -b
> 
> or
> 
>   usbgadget -S auto,/tmp/fitimage(fitimage)c

> +Board code authors are encouraged to provide a default environment containing
> +partitions with descriptive names. For boards where this is not specified,
> +there exist a number of **partition** specifiers for automatically generating entries:
> +
> +* ``nvmem`` exports all registered NVMEM devices (e.g. EEPROMs, Fuse banks)

Blindly exporting NVMEM devices is not a good idea. As the description
says it's used for fuse banks. These are write-once and modifying them
is potentially dangerous. Also it's fastboot which means you can't even
read them before modifying them and there is no way to only partially
write them.

There might be good reasons to export some specific NVMEM device, but
then this should be explicitly exported and not by default.

> +static bool file_list_handle_spec(struct file_list *files, const char *spec)
> +{
> +	unsigned count = 0;
> +
> +	if (!strcmp(spec, "auto")) {
> +		count += file_list_add_blockdevs(files);
> +		count += file_list_add_nvmemdevs(files);
> +	} else if (!strcmp(spec, "block")) {
> +		count += file_list_add_blockdevs(files);
> +	} else if (!strcmp(spec, "nvmem")) {
> +		count += file_list_add_nvmemdevs(files);
> +	} else {
> +		return false;
> +	}

Since you are talking about future extensions you could parse "auto"
first and set a flag variable for it:

	bool auto = false;

	if (!strcmp(spec, "auto"))
		auto = true;
	if (!strcmp(spec, "block") || auto)
		count += file_list_add_blockdevs(files);
	if (!strcmp(spec, "nvmem") || auto)
		count += file_list_add_nvmemdevs(files);

That would make it a bit easier to integrate the future extensions into
the code.
